How long can you live with hepatitis B?

How long you can live with hepatitis B depends on the specific situation. If the liver function is normal and the abdominal ultrasound is normal, you can live to a normal life expectancy. If there is already an obvious stage of cirrhotic decompensation, the life expectancy in this case is greatly reduced. As long as there is no obvious cirrhosis of the liver, no obvious cirrhosis of the liver, ascites, this situation, you can live to a normal life expectancy. Even if the liver function is obviously abnormal or repeatedly abnormal, it is necessary to actively deal with it at this time. For example, appropriate liver protection and enzyme lowering treatment can be given, such as those who meet the conditions of antiviral indications, standardized anti-hepatitis B virus treatment can be given to stabilize liver function in the normal range and control the virus to low levels or undetectable. Long-term this will allow you to live a normal life expectancy and will not affect the quality of life.
